Transaction 21e23f8cad4b70ceab0576040404f3b58ae38c86443702b2d641cebe46939905
1 Input
2 Outputs
- 21e23f8cad4b70ceab0576040404f3b58ae38c86443702b2d641cebe46939905:0
- 21e23f8cad4b70ceab0576040404f3b58ae38c86443702b2d641cebe46939905:1
value 240000
address 3N3rSLPUHmbv7x2cgrVhRige72yqf3XGmr
value 14634947
address 35ZS3m3PnkV7QBui96hA5iQ1Kq8FG2Qm11